How does a shading device impact energy performance?

Explanation:
Shading devices influence energy performance by controlling how much solar radiation enters a building through the windows. By blocking direct sun during hot seasons, they reduce cooling loads and heat gain, helping keep interiors cooler with less air conditioning. At the same time, when properly designed, shading devices still admit ample daylight but filter it to avoid glare, improving daylight distribution so spaces are well lit without excessive heat. This combination makes shading a key tool in balancing comfort and energy use. They don’t replace insulation, which reduces heat transfer through the building envelope regardless of sun exposure. They don’t increase solar heat gain; their purpose is to limit it. And they don’t replace artificial lighting; while shading can improve daylight quality, some electric lighting is still often needed.
